Output 26f25e6cf9922642b65fc23358ed676a71eb92ec931a78fdc0a29b8ce0050815:0

value
4122824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ddf3b850c88da9a077a52ccb465fd590d8783f63 OP_EQUAL
address
3MvbDu8KTPobL5G3ovw9LCTWaKjP2JzCtw
transaction
26f25e6cf9922642b65fc23358ed676a71eb92ec931a78fdc0a29b8ce0050815
spent
true